House Plan Specifications:
Sq. Ft.: 2,498 | Stories: 1 | ||
Bedrooms: 3 | Garage Spaces: 3 |
An eco-friendly and spacious ranch style house plan with 3 bedrooms and an easy to access front porch. The stone, siding, and cedar shake blend wonderfully together to create a unique look for this rustic ranch style home.

The front of the eco-friendly, spacious house.
The stone, siding, and cedar shake blend excellently together to create an uncommon look for this picturesque eco-friendly ranch-style home with a full front porch, ideal for peaceful evenings. Inside, we have the open great room, a casual dining room along an extensive kitchen. The central area features a two-story stone fireplace.
All the rooms have access and views past the outdoor veranda and barbeque porch. This is ideal for a lake, mountain, golf course, or scenic back yard lots. The last surprise is the hidden stairs, behind the fireplace. This offers a second-story future space, for a potential loft, living area, and of course storage.
